Social Casinos vs. Demo Modes: Key Differences

When you search for free slots on your computer, you’ll run into two distinct types of platforms. Understanding the difference saves you from wasting time on a format that doesn’t suit you. The first is the Demo Mode found at real-money online casinos. These are trial versions of the exact same games you’d play for cash. The Return to Player (RTP) percentages are identical to the real-money versions, making them perfect for testing betting strategies or just checking out new mechanics like Megaways or Cluster Pays without risking a dime.

The second category is Social Casinos (also known as sweepstakes casinos). Platforms like High 5 Casino, Gambino Slots, or Slotomania operate entirely on a virtual currency model. You buy gold coins to play for fun, and you often get free sweeps coins as a bonus. The gameplay here is designed for entertainment and “ grinding” for levels or achievements, similar to a video game. While you can’t cash out directly from gold coin play, social casinos often run tournaments and loyalty programs that feel very different from the solitary experience of a demo slot. For many PC players, the social aspect—chat rooms and leaderboards—adds a layer of engagement that demo modes lack.

Navigating State Regulations and Availability

One of the biggest advantages of playing free slots on PC is accessibility. Unlike real-money casinos, which require you to be physically located within state borders like New Jersey or West Virginia to log in, social casinos operate legally in almost every US state (excluding Washington and Idaho in some cases). This means you can download the client or log in via Chrome or Edge from anywhere in the country.

However, if you are in a regulated state and want to play demo versions of slots you might eventually play for real money, sites like DraftKings Casino or FanDuel Casino offer robust desktop platforms. You can access their libraries in “practice mode” often without even creating an account, though some states require you to register and verify your age before the reels spin even for free. It is always worth checking the specific terms of the casino lobby before assuming you can play anonymously.

Security and Software Considerations

Even when playing for free, you shouldn’t ignore security. If a site asks for a credit card to play a “free” game, walk away. Legitimate social casinos only ask for payment details when you choose to purchase additional coin packages, not to play the base games. When playing on PC, ensure your browser is updated to the latest version to support modern encryption and HTML5 rendering.

Be wary of standalone software downloads from unknown developers. The safest route is sticking to browser-based play or downloading official apps from the Microsoft Store if you prefer a standalone window. Reputable operators like BetRivers or Caesars Slots have dedicated Windows applications that provide a secure, sandboxed environment for their games. This prevents the annoying pop-ups and adware that often accompany third-party “free slots” executables found on obscure download sites.

FAQ

Do I need to download software to play free slots on my PC?

No, most modern free slots run on HTML5 technology directly in your web browser (Chrome, Firefox, Edge). You can play instantly without downloading any executable files. However, some casinos like Chumba or Gambino offer optional desktop apps for a more integrated experience.

Can I play free casino slots on PC if I live in a state where gambling is illegal?

Yes. Social casinos and sweepstakes casinos are legal in the vast majority of US states because no purchase is necessary to play and you are playing with virtual currency. They are classified as entertainment products rather than gambling under current federal law.

Are the odds in free play slots the same as real money slots?

It depends on the platform. If you are playing the “Demo Mode” at a licensed real-money casino (like BetMGM or Caesars), the RTP and volatility are usually identical to the real-money version. Social casinos may have different payout structures as they are designed for entertainment and progression.

Can I win real money playing free slots on my computer?

Generally, no. “Free slots” usually imply play-money credits. However, Sweepstakes Casinos (like High 5 Casino or Fortune Coins) allow you to play with Sweeps Coins, which can technically be redeemed for cash prizes or gift cards if you meet specific playthrough requirements.

Why do free slots sites ask for my email address?

Legitimate sites require email verification for account creation, coin saving, and responsible gaming features. This protects them from bots and ensures you can recover your progress. If a site asks for credit card info before you’ve agreed to a purchase, you should exit immediately.
